Catherine Zeta-Jones has candidly spoken about the ups and downs of her 18-year marriage to Michael Douglas, revealing the secret to their success is sharing a “very open relationship” with each other.
The actress, 49, gave a no-holds-barred interview to America’s Savannah Guthrie and Hoda Kotb on NBC News’ TODAY show, and also opened up on how they spoke to their children Dylan, 18, and Carys, 15, about past sexual misconduct allegations made against their father – as well as the impact the claims had on their marriage.
When the presenters praised the actress for being open and honest on both the positive and negative sides of her marriage in the past, she explained: “First of all, I’m so happy that we’ve made it to be 20 years together. It’s been great, but I think it’s just unfathomable to me that you would be with one person for 18 years and things are not rosy every day. They’re just not.
“Both Michael and I have a very open relationship. When you have kids that didn’t ask to be born into a world where it’s scrutinised or looked into… You’ve got to be open and honest and share things that probably people at the drugstore wouldn’t share over the counter.”
Catherine recently opened up about serious allegations waged against her husband Michael Douglas earlier this year in an interview with the Sunday Times, admitting that she and their children were “devastated” by the claims.
She said in the chat that she ended up having an open conversation with her husband with both of her children in the room and addressing the interview on the TODAY show, Catherine added: “We share everything around the table…
“I’m a big European kind of family girl and so, everything is shared around the table– issues with my daughter, if she’s feeling insecure, she’s a teenager, girls can be mean.

“My son just going off to college – what that is for him and what this is for me, (because I never let on that I miss him terribly because he’s having such a great time), so all these conversations get around the table and then, I think you clear the air and everyone knows what’s going on. There’s no big surprises.”
Michael previously denied the allegations made against him, saying at the time: “This is a complete lie, fabrication, no truth to it whatsoever.”
While Catherine said there have been ups and downs in her marriage, she insisted: “I don’t throw the towel in very quickly on anything.”
